The live forecast above shows the current conditions and outlook for Moreton-in-Marsh. This Cotswold market town experiences a temperate maritime climate, with mild summers and cool, damp winters, making spring and early autumn the most reliable times for a visit.

What are the best months to visit and what should I pack?

May, June and September offer the best balance of decent weather and lighter crowds. July and August are warmest but also the busiest, especially with school holidays pushing up prices for local accommodation. Pack a waterproof jacket and layers even in summer, as showers are common year-round. In winter, bring a warm coat, sturdy footwear and a scarf for exploring the Cotswold hills.

Does Moreton-in-Marsh get snow often?

Light snowfall occurs a few times each winter, but heavy snow is rare. When it does settle, it can disrupt local roads and rail services, so check live travel updates via Birmingham weather for the broader region.

Is Moreton-in-Marsh warmer than the rest of the Cotswolds?

Temperatures are broadly similar, though the town’s valley location can trap cold air overnight, making frost more common in winter. Summer days are usually mild and pleasant, rarely exceeding 28°C.
